What is the history and significance of this attraction/city?

Macy's is a historic American department store founded in 1858 in New York City. It's well-known for its role in shaping retail culture and for hosting the annual Macy's Thanksgiving Day Parade, which draws millions of viewers each year. Macy's flagship store in Herald Square is considered an iconic landmark in NYC.

Where is it located and how do I get there (metro, bus, taxi, walking)?

Macy's is located at 151 West 34th Street, New York City, NY. It is easily accessible via the subway (B, D, F, M, N, Q, R, and W lines at Herald Square Station), bus, taxi, or by walking from nearby landmarks like Times Square.
